Advances in Digital Image Compression by Adaptive Thinning

This paper proposes a novel concept for digital image compression. The resulting compression scheme relies on adaptive thinning algorithms, which are recent multiresolution methods from scattered data approximation. Adaptive thinning algorithms are recursive point removal schemes, which are combined with piecewise linear interpolation over decremental Delaunay triangulations. This paper shows the utility of adaptive thinning algorithms in digital image compression. To this end, specific adaptive pixel removal criteria are designed for multiresolution modelling of digital images. This is combined with a previous customized coding scheme for scattered data. The good performance of our compression scheme is finally shown in comparison with the well-established wavelet-based compression method SPIHT.
